The Concept Trading vs The5ers: Elite Prop Firms Comparison
Introduction
The Concept Trading and The5ers are two prominent prop trading firms that offer aspiring traders pathways to professional trading careers. The Concept Trading stands out for its innovative dual account system and more flexible trading parameters, earning it a solid 4.6/5 Trustpilot rating from 443 reviews. The5ers is widely recognized for its two-phase evaluation model and scaling opportunities, boasting an impressive 4.8/5 Trustpilot rating from over 21,000 reviews. Both firms provide funded accounts to successful traders, but their approaches to evaluation, profit splits, and scaling options differ significantly, making each better suited for different types of traders.

FAQ
What makes The Concept Trading popular among users?
The Concept Trading has gained popularity for its one-rule structure (do not breach the static drawdown), with no daily loss limits and no restrictions on trading style across most programs. This unique approach, combined with higher profit splits (up to 90%), more flexible trading parameters, and significantly lower entry fees compared to competitors, appeals to traders who want faster funding with fewer restrictions. Their no separate reset fee policy and absence of time limits for completing challenges also makes them attractive to traders who prefer a less pressured evaluation process.
How does The5ers differ from other similar organizations?
The5ers stands out with its comprehensive scaling plan that can take traders from small accounts up to $4 million, which is among the highest in the industry. Their three program structures (Hyper Growth 1-Step, High Stakes 2-Step, Bootcamp 3-Step) are designed to identify consistent, disciplined traders rather than just those who can hit profit targets. The firm is also known for its extensive educational resources, active trader community, and exceptional customer support. Unlike many competitors, The5ers focuses on Forex, Indices, and Commodities (no crypto or stocks), and their longevity since 2016 in business gives them credibility many newer prop firms lack.
Which has better profit-sharing terms between The Concept Trading and The5ers?
Both firms reach high profit splits at the top end – The Concept Trading via its 90% Lock Rule and The5ers scaling up to 100% for top performers. The Concept Trading entry-tier programs may start at 50%, scaling to 90% via the Lock Rule. The5ers starts at 80% and scales to 100% based on performance milestones. However, it’s important to consider that The5ers’ scaling program can lead to significantly larger account sizes over time, which might compensate for the lower percentage split for high-volume traders.
Are there significant differences in the evaluation processes?
Yes, the evaluation processes differ substantially. The Concept Trading uses a single-step evaluation on Traditional, Premier, Empire, and Xtreme (Foundation is 2-stage), with no daily drawdown limit and no minimum trading days on the 1-step programs. The5ers employs a traditional two-phase challenge model with their standard program, requiring traders to first pass Level 1 and then complete a more extended Level 2 evaluation (with 15 and 30 minimum trading days respectively). The5ers’ Hyper Growth program offers a 1-step evaluation with a 10% target and news trading allowed, while High Stakes (2-step) requires a minimum of 3 profitable trading days per phase.
Which firm is better for beginners vs. experienced traders?
Beginners might find The Concept Trading more accessible due to its lower entry costs, simpler evaluation structure, and more lenient trading parameters. The absence of time pressure also allows new traders to develop at their own pace. Experienced traders looking for long-term career development might prefer The5ers for its established reputation, comprehensive educational resources, and substantial scaling opportunities that can lead to managing multi-million dollar accounts. The5ers’ more stringent criteria tend to favor disciplined, consistent traders who have already developed solid risk management skills.
